  • Abstract
    This poster/demo highlights research done at Oracle´s Warsaw Mobile and Wireless Center of Expertise to develop and manage in a dynamic way new services for telecommunications/data networks. Called Dynamic Active Networks Services (DANS), the architecture combines legacy and new components of a network with a set of protocols and algorithms by which networks operators and service providers can actively provide users with a wide range of services. We propose architecture and protocols for defining new services. The architecture treats the entire service environment as a dynamic, distributed system and we leverage concepts from Active Networking to deal with active nodes providing services within a network. The novelty is the ties between distributed systems and active networking.
